Cluster releases Hakchi2 v.2.20, adding support for SNES Classic.

snes-classic.jpg


It's been a while since we've seen a release from Alexey 'Cluster' Avdyukhin, and this new version of hakchi2 is surely not going to disappoint. The release number is v.2.20, and it adds SNES Classic support (!!!), 7zip compression support, among other huge things. Many GBAtemp users have seen massive success with this new release, and as much as I'd like to try it, I don't have an SNES Classic, so it's up to you to try it out.
